What are the typical career advancement opportunities for professionals in Mass Communication?
Professionals in Mass Communication can advance into senior roles such as Media Manager, Communications Director, Public Relations Specialist, or Content Strategist. With experience, many transition into specialized areas like digital media, corporate communications, or broadcast management. Continuous skill development and networking can also open doors to positions in media consultancy or academia. Career growth often depends on gaining a strong portfolio, staying updated with industry trends, and building a robust professional network.
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Mass Communication position, and why are they important?
To thrive in Mass Communication, you need proficiency in written and verbal communication, media production, and audience analysis, often supported by a relevant degree in communications, journalism, or media studies. Familiarity with digital publishing tools, content management systems, audio/video editing software, and certification in public relations or digital marketing is highly advantageous. Creativity, adaptability, strong interpersonal skills, and the ability to work under tight deadlines make candidates stand out. These skills ensure effective message delivery, audience engagement, and successful coordination across various media platforms and teams.

What is a Mass Communication job?
A Mass Communication job involves creating, delivering, and managing information across various media platforms to reach a large audience. Professionals may work in journalism, public relations, broadcasting, advertising, or digital media. They develop content, manage communication strategies, and use media tools to engage and inform the public. Strong writing, presentation, and analytical skills are essential for success in this field.

About the College:
The Lamar D. Fain College of Fine Arts encompasses undergraduate programs in art, mass communication, music and theatre. The college prides itself on ensuring that its students do what they study and is committed to offering individualized instruction in functional, safe, modern surroundings. Emphasis is placed on applying classroom learning to process and performance. Students are taught to create within their disciplines and are also challenged to evaluate the quality of what they have created, to assess the effect of their creations on the wider culture, and to aspire to professionalism and excellence.
About the Department/School/Area:
The mission of the Mass Communication program is to prepare graduates for employment in the multidiscipline media arena and/or graduate education. Our curriculum stresses theoretical principles, such as First Amendment law, media ethics and media history, as well practical application, including skills such as public speaking, writing, editing, production and digital media. Our students win awards in state, regional and national competitions on an annual basis. Alumni have won Pulitzer Prizes and gone on to some of the best graduate schools in the country.

Established in 1922, Midwestern State University is a public university in Wichita Falls, Texas, located halfway between Oklahoma City and the Dallas-Fort Worth metroplex. The university has an average enrollment of 5,800 students, with approximately 20% enrolled in graduate programs. Rooted in a values-based culture, Midwestern State University aims to empower students and our community through a commitment to academic excellence, personal growth, and a culture of lifelong learning, inquiry, and innovation. The university is strongly committed to serving first-generation students and those receiving financial assistance.
